Dr. Fernando Nebrera Navarro is a specialist in Internal Medicine and sees patients at several private hospitals in Seville. His work focuses on cardiovascular risk — that is, preventing and treating conditions such as hypertension, diabetes, high cholesterol and obesity, which can seriously affect long-term health.

He has particular expertise in women's health during menopause, a stage at which hormonal changes directly affect metabolism and increase cardiovascular risk. For this reason, he takes a comprehensive approach that considers both the physical changes and the emotional impact that can accompany this stage.

His way of working is based on a thorough and personalised assessment, focused on the prevention, detection and monitoring of conditions that can appear or worsen during menopause, such as obesity, diabetes, hypertension, cholesterol disorders, osteoporosis and changes in mood. His goal is to improve the health and quality of life of each patient in an individualised way.

About nutritionist Sol Velasco

Sol Velasco is a clinical nutritionist specialising in women's hormonal, metabolic and digestive health. She works in private practice, supporting women in perimenopause and menopause who are experiencing changes in weight, digestion and general wellbeing.

During menopause, hormonal changes affect metabolism, promote the accumulation of fat — especially abdominal fat — and disrupt digestion. Her work therefore focuses on fat loss and weight management, taking into account factors such as inflammation, fluid retention and loss of muscle mass.

Digestive health is a key part of her work, addressing common symptoms such as bloating, constipation and food intolerances, which often prevent treatments from working.

Her support is entirely personalised, evidence-based and tailored to our patients, with the aim of improving quality of life, restoring metabolic balance and helping them feel comfortable in their bodies again.
